Printer files network It is a solution copied from a previous post of Provost.
First do the following:
- Print a printer wireless network Test report
- Print a Page of Setup network printer
Possible solutions:
- Move the printer to be closer to the router if the wireless network Test report indicates the intensity of the signal is "Very low" or "Low".
- Move the printer away from the router if currently less than 1 m (3 ft.).
- Look at the last page of the Network Configuration Page. Near wireless networks appears along with the channels they use. Together, the channel of your router to channel 1, 6 or 11 according to the proximity of other channels are and how many networks use each channel. Having other channels of network near your (less than 5 channels) is not good. Using a channel that is heavily used by other networks is also not good. Do not use the setting "Auto" from the channel on the router.
- Change the width of your router to 20 MHz channel (or 54 Mbit/s). Do not use 40 MHz (or 300Mbps) parameters or 20/40 MHz (Auto).
- If the wireless network Test report indicates 'more than a wireless router was found which corresponds to your wireless network (SSID)... name ', try changing the name of your network in your router to something unique.
Note: you will need to reconnect all the wireless devices that connect to your network using the new network name.
- Make sure that the "Auto off" function of the printer is disabled. If this feature is enabled, the printer turns OFF after a period of inactivity.
- If you use an Extender 'Wireless' to extend the wireless signal, try turning it off to see if the problem goes away.
- If you still have questions, set a static IP address on the printer. This can be done using the Home Page (EWS of the printer) or from the Panel on many models of printer printers. Several models of printers have a feature 'suggests the IP address. Use this feature if you are not sure what setting to use IP address.
Note: you may need to use the "" Update IP address"utility provided by the printer software to update the software with the new IP address.

Salvation for the end user.
I see that you are having a problem with put the printer on the network again.
I'll be happy to help you.
I would like to reset the printer first to clear the previous network settings.
Turn the printer off, press and hold the wireless button and cancel (x button) while turning the printer on and do not release both buttons until the printer stops making the noise.Print a configuration report and check the SSID address and IP are disabled.
(hold down the x key and when the printer makes a noise to let go of taken)After the reset, unplug the router power cable, wait 10 seconds, then reconnect the power cable.
Wait, it's ready.
Because the USB connection does not work now, unplug the USB cable.
Run uninstall from the CD or the program files.
Here are the steps to run the uninstall of the computer or the CD.
To uninstall program files:
Go to start and select a computer.
Select the C drive.
Select the program files or program files x 86.
Open the HP name and printer folder.
Select uninstall.
Uninstall from the CD:
Go to start, computer,
Make a left click Open in a new window, right click on the printer CD, double click on uninstall.
Run the Setup again and do not connect the USB cable until you are prompted to configure the wireless again.
Test the printer.
I would setup an IP address from the printer so that it does not happen in the future.
Printer keeps not WiFi. Proceed to Solution 4: assign your printer a static IP address.

Config looks good - just as domestic mine to my local network. The only thing I can think is that you may have entered commands in the wrong order - which means, you could have isakmp or encryption before the config map was complete. Write memory, then reloading the pix is a way to reset everything. If you do not want downtime:
mymap outside crypto map interface
ISAKMP allows outside
Enter these two commands should be enough to reset the ipsec and isakmp.
